美文网首页
JavaScript-函数

JavaScript-函数

作者: 一条眼镜蛇 | 来源:发表于2018-08-15 23:13 被阅读0次

函数大家应该都熟悉,定义啊啥的就不多说,这边主要介绍JavaScript函数的一些特点和需要注意的地方。

返回值:JavaScript函数在定义时不必指定是否返回值,任何函数在任何时候都可以通过return语句后跟要返回的值来实现返回值。如果你需要提前终止执行一个函数,可以使用return 不跟返回值。

参数:JavaScript函数的参数跟大多数其他语言函数的参数有所不同,它不限制传进去的个数和参数类型。参数使用中,你可以在函数中使用参数名来获取参数值,可以使用argumentsi来获取,也可以参数名和arguments混合使用,可以使用arguments.length来获取参数的总个数。需要注意的是最好不要使用eval或者arguments作为参数名。

重载:JavaScript函数没有重载,如果定义了两个名字相同的函数,该名字属于后定义的函数。

相关文章

  • 函数节流(throttle)与函数去抖(debounce)

    JavaScript-性能优化,函数节流(throttle)与函数去抖(debounce)JS魔法堂:函数节流(t...

  • JavaScript-函数

    JavaScript可以用关键字function来定义函数,函数的调用也不必放在函数声明之后,因为JavaScri...

  • JavaScript-函数

    函数大家应该都熟悉,定义啊啥的就不多说,这边主要介绍JavaScript函数的一些特点和需要注意的地方。 返回值:...

  • JavaScript-函数

    函数是值。它们可以在代码的任何地方被分配,复制或声明。 因为sayHi后没有括号,不会执行函数在代码块的结尾不需要...

  • JavaScript-什么是函数

    JavaScript-什么是函数 函数是完成某个特定功能的一组语句。如没有函数,完成任务可能需要五行、十行、甚至更...

  • 04、JavaScript-函数

    每天一句:想说会有多少人问自己一下几个问题“你这辈子到底要什么,要做怎么样的人?你现在能够做什么?你正在做什么?你...

  • JavaScript-数组、函数

    1 - 数组 1.1 数组的概念 数组是指一组数据的集合,是一个有序的列表,其中的每个数据被称作元素,在数组中可以...

  • JavaScript-函数进阶

    1 - 函数的定义和调用 1.1 函数的定义方式 命名函数function fn(){} 匿名函数var fn =...

  • JavaScript-内置函数

    一、内置函数 二、字符串函数 2-1:substr(起始位置,截取长度) 2-2:substring(起始位置,结...

  • Javascript-函数闭包

    javascript函数闭包一直是本人没搞懂,概念模糊的盲点。在项目中也遇到过,只是当真正的代码放我面前的时候我还...

网友评论

      本文标题:JavaScript-函数

      本文链接:https://www.haomeiwen.com/subject/klygbftx.html